Castle of Chanteloup

Monument in Amboise

The castle of Chanteloup is located on the heights of the town of Amboise, in the department of Indre-et-Loire.

It was built from 1715 for the Princess of Ursins, and became the property in 1763 of the Duke of Choiseul, main minister of Louis XV from 1758 and 1770.

The Duke had major works carried out both at the level of the castle as well as its exteriors. In 1770, fallen into disgrace, he settled there permanently. Sumptuous receptions are organized, and a real court takes advantage of the place, where Choiseul receives visitors from all over Europe.

During the Revolution, the estate was seized and then sold as national property in 1794: part of the furniture was however saved and transferred to the Museum of Fine Arts in Tours.

In the meantime, the scientist and Minister Chaptal has for some time become the master of the links. However, in 1823, the castle ended up being destroyed by property dealers.

All that remains of the splendid property are the French gardens, the beauty of which was sometimes compared to the gardens of Versailles, two pavilions, the caretaker's house and especially the Pagoda: it is an architectural "madness" erected in 1775, designed by Louis-Denis Le Camus and which the Duke of Choiseul had nicknamed his "Monument dedicated to Friendship".

40 meters high, next to a small Chinese garden and a beautiful pond, the building is supported by 16 columns and 16 pillars and its seven floors are built in the form of domes. An internal stone and then mahogany staircase guarded by a wrought iron banister leads to the summit from where you can enjoy a panorama of the forest and the Loire Valley.

The site listed in the Inventory is still private but open to the public from mid-March to mid-November. In addition to the Pagoda, visitors can discover the gardens and walk there over a dozen hectares, discover ancient games or learn about the past of the place via an iconographic museum.
